Day: August 10, 2022

US prison

U.S. Government’s Global Hypocrisy Ridiculed

The U.S. Government holds in its prisons a higher percentage of its citizens than does any other government anywhere on the planet but accuses every national government that it seeks to overthrow and replace, of being a ‘police state’ (and therefore supposedly deserving to be overthrown and replaced). On 8 […]

UN in New York

Punishing Whistleblowers At The United Nations

The United Nations prides itself on exposing, monitoring and noting the travails and vicissitudes to be found on this troubled planet.  It also prides itself on being the premier international institution that protects, or at the very least keeps an eye out for, the principles of the Charter that underpin […]